Hatice Yildiz Durak; Nilüfer Atman Uslu – Interactive Learning Environments, 2024
The purpose of this study is to examine the effect of flexible thinking and achievement emotions in predicting goal-setting, time management, and self-evaluation in the context of online learning. In the study, 438 students at six different universities participated. The proposed structural model was analyzed by PLS-SEM. In the structural model,…
